随着计算机技术的突飞猛进以及移动通讯技术在日常生活中的不断深入,数据采集不断地向多路、高速、智能化的方向发展。本文针对此需求,实现了一种应用FPGA的多路、高速的数据采集系统,从而为测量仪器提供良好的采集数据。 本文设计了一种基于AD+FPGA+DSP的多路数据采集处理系统,针对此系统设计了基于AD9446的模数转换采集板,再将模数转换采集板的数据传送至基于FPGA的采集控制模块进行数据的压缩以及缓冲存储,最后由DSP调入数据进行数据的处理。本文的设计主要分为两部分,一部分为模数转换采集板的设计与调试,另一部分为采集控制模块的设计与仿真。 经设计与调试,模数转换模块可为系统提供稳定可靠的数据,能稳定工作在百兆的频率下;采集控制模块能实时地完成数据压缩与数据缓冲,并能通过时钟管理模块来控制前端AD的采样,该模块也能稳定工作在百兆的频率下。该系统为多路、高速的数据采集系统,并能稳定工作,从而能满足电子测量仪器的要求。
上传时间: 2013-05-24
上传用户:chuckbassboy
本文结合目前国内外航电数据处理系统的发展概况,设计了一款集数据采集、处理、控制及传输于一体的航电处理系统。文章首先深入研究了自适应滤波器原理,分析了LMS算法性能,着重从影响算法性能的因素入手,通过分析仿真,改进...
上传时间: 2013-07-18
上传用户:wuyuying
·摘 要:本文介绍基于计算机并行端口的微型步进电机控制系统。针对双极型两相步进电机,设计了由集成音频功率放大器TDA1521组成的步进电机平衡桥式功率驱动电路;由计算机并行端口的数据端口组成步进电机的脉冲分配器,由软件实现步进电机的脉冲分配、电机的速度控制和断电相位记忆功能,通过对数据端口的扩展实现对6个步进电机的控制。
上传时间: 2013-07-15
上传用户:lepoke
·摘要: 以IPC+DSP作为六自由度工业机器人的控制器,设计了一种基于可编程多轴控制器PMAC(Programmable Multi-Axies Controller)的开放式机器人控制系统.采用Visual C++编制控制程序,将机器人系统中管理、控制功能的实现分为若干个模块,负责底层伺服驱动的函数利用PMAC运动语言编写,可直接调用.整个控制软件能完成数据及运动状态显示、伺服驱动、
上传时间: 2013-05-25
上传用户:qwe1234
·摘要: fuzzyTECH软件可以用于创建模糊系统,然后用神经网络和样本数据对所创建的模糊系统进行训练,最后可以针对不同的单片机或DSP硬件平台自动产生相应的程序代码,直接应用到系统的调试中去.fuzzyTECH很好地解决了在单片机或DSP的有限资源中如何编制高效的应用程序以实现复杂的模糊控制算法的问题.它降低了实现模糊控制算法的难度,也加快了设计模糊控制算法的速度.文章最后给出了用f
上传时间: 2013-05-25
上传用户:trepb001
本文结合目前国内外航电数据处理系统的发展概况,设计了一款集数据采集、处理、控制及传输于一体的航电处理系统。文章首先深入研究了自适应滤波器原理,分析了LMS算法性能,着重从影响算法性能的因素入手,通过分析仿真,改进算法,提升了算法性能,给出仿真结果分析,并设计应用于系统之中;其次介绍了ARINC-429航空总线和RS-422串行总线的信息标准和传输格式。在此基础上,设计了基于FPGA的解决航电系统数据采集、滤波处理、控制传输和复杂非线性运算的一体化实现方案。选用XILINX公司的FPGA,实现了航电数据采集、传输和控制,集成了ARlNC-429和RS-422两种通信接口,实现了总线冗余,并实现了数据滤波和相应的算法处理。最后,在实验室环境下,对每个模块分别进行了软硬件测试。
上传时间: 2013-07-01
上传用户:R50974
神经网络控制算法作为一种比较成熟的智能控制算法,在空空导弹的理论研究中也得到了很多应用,但它的实际应用通常是通过软件实现的,而软件实现是串行执行指令,运行速度慢,可靠性低,很难满足实际导弹制导系统实时性的要求。控制算法硬件实现的最大特点就是可提高控制算法的实时运算速度和可靠性。本课题针对导弹制导系统,以FPGA为硬件平台研究神经网络控制算法的硬件实现。本文首先对BP神经网络算法思想进行了深入分析,并对BP网络的各个阶段进行了理论推导,最后对BP神经网络PID飞行控制算法进行了研究和总结,为硬件实现提供了理论基础。基于对上述理论的深入研究和分析,本文提出了一种适合FPGA实现该神经网络控制算法的硬件实现模型。在该模型中,神经网络各层之间采用串行执行数据方式,层间则采用并行运行方式,可有效提高系统的运算速度。由于模块化、层次化的自顶向下的模块化设计方法可有效减少错误的产生,是设计复杂大规模系统的理想设计方法。本文采用了此设计方法,通过把系统模块化,对各个子模块分别用VHDL硬件描述语言进行描述,并基于QUARTUS II软件开发平台进行综合和仿真,直到达到研究设计要求。最后将仿真程序源代码下载配置到具体的Cyclone II系列EP2C70 FPGA芯片中,应用于某实际导弹控制系统的研究。理论分析和实验结果表明该神经网络飞行控制算法的FPGA硬件实现是有效可行的,可满足系统实时性的要求,为制导系统的实际工程实现提供了基础。
上传时间: 2013-04-24
上传用户:冇尾飞铊
· 摘要: 介绍一种基于DSP的无线和有线USB接口的数据传输系统,实现无线USB和有线USB之间的通信,将无线USB数据传输到PC机,解决无线USB设备向PC机兼容问题.该系统可实现无线USB的62.5 kbps的数据传输速率,有线USB的实际传输速率达到100 Mbps,可以实现高速实时的数据传输.由于以DSP为核心处理器,适合于语音和控制系统的应用.该系统具有小型化、低功
上传时间: 2013-04-24
上传用户:璇珠官人
·论文摘要: 从中小型变电站的数学模型入手,通过数学模型地推导,指出单一的PLC 控制在无人变电站控制决策中无法高速处理数据的局限,由此提出以DSP + PLC主从式结构实现无人变电站的电压和无功模糊智能自动控制策略。具体介绍了采用DSP 为计算核心完成基于模糊边界的电压无功九域图控制策略判断,由PLC 完成具体电气控制操作的实
上传时间: 2013-06-12
上传用户:小儒尼尼奥
·简介:数据与计算机通信是当今通信与计算机界的热门话题。本书内容丰富新颖,涉及最基本的数据通信原理、各种类型的计算机网络以及多种网络协议和应用。这一版本增加的新内容主要有:用双绞线进行宽带接入的xDSL技术、千兆位以太网和100Mb/s以太网、可用比特率ABR服务和机制、TCP的拥塞控制、IP组播技术、Internet中的综合服务、区分服务,以及服务质量QoS和资源预约协议RSVP等。此外,本书还包
上传时间: 2013-07-02
上传用户:moqi